gis什么时候需要建立数据库
-
GIS(地理信息系统)需要建立数据库的时间是在以下情况下:
-
数据管理:建立数据库是为了有效地存储、组织和管理地理数据。当需要处理大量的地理数据时,数据库可以提供高效的数据存储和检索功能,以支持地理数据的管理和分析。
-
空间分析:GIS中的空间分析需要基于地理数据进行计算和分析。建立数据库可以存储和管理空间数据,并提供空间查询和分析功能,以支持空间分析的实施。
-
数据共享和集成:建立数据库可以方便地实现地理数据的共享和集成。不同部门或组织内的地理数据可以存储在同一个数据库中,提供给相关人员进行共享和使用,从而实现数据的集成和协同工作。
-
决策支持:GIS在决策支持中起着重要的作用。建立数据库可以存储和管理与决策相关的地理数据,为决策者提供准确、及时的地理信息,以支持决策的制定和执行。
-
空间规划和管理:建立数据库可以支持空间规划和管理工作。地理数据可以被用于制定城市规划、土地利用规划、环境保护等方面的政策和计划。数据库的建立可以提供数据支持,帮助规划和管理人员进行空间分析和决策。
总之,建立数据库是为了有效地管理和利用地理数据,支持GIS的应用和分析。在需要处理大量地理数据、进行空间分析、实现数据共享和集成、支持决策和空间规划等方面时,建立数据库是必要的。
1年前 -
-
GIS(地理信息系统)需要建立数据库的时候有很多情况,以下是几个常见的情况:
-
数据集较大:当需要处理大量地理数据时,建立数据库可以更有效地存储和管理数据。数据库可以提供高效的数据存储和检索功能,使得数据的访问和处理更加快捷和方便。
-
多源数据整合:GIS常常需要整合来自不同来源的数据,这些数据可能以不同的格式和结构存储。建立数据库可以将这些数据集中存储,并提供统一的数据模型和查询接口,方便数据的整合和分析。
-
多用户共享:如果多个用户需要同时访问和共享地理数据,建立数据库可以提供数据共享和多用户并发访问的功能。数据库可以实现数据的权限管理和安全控制,确保数据的安全性和完整性。
-
空间分析需求:GIS常常需要进行空间分析,例如缓冲区分析、叠加分析等。建立数据库可以提供空间索引和查询功能,加快空间数据的查询和分析速度。
-
数据更新和维护:地理数据通常需要进行更新和维护,例如添加新的地理要素、更新属性信息等。建立数据库可以提供数据的版本管理和事务处理功能,确保数据的一致性和完整性。
总之,建立数据库对于GIS来说是非常重要的,可以提高数据的存储效率和访问速度,方便数据的共享和分析,同时也有助于数据的更新和维护。建立数据库可以使GIS系统更加高效和可靠,提升地理信息的利用价值。
1年前 -
-
GIS(地理信息系统)是一个集地理空间数据采集、存储、管理、分析和可视化为一体的信息系统。建立数据库是GIS的一个重要环节,它可以提供高效的数据管理和查询功能,使得GIS系统能够更好地支持决策和规划工作。以下是GIS需要建立数据库的几个主要情况:
-
数据存储和管理:GIS系统需要存储大量的地理空间数据,包括地图、矢量数据、栅格数据等。而数据库提供了统一的数据存储和管理平台,可以方便地对数据进行组织、存储和管理,保证数据的完整性和一致性。
-
数据查询和分析:GIS系统需要对地理空间数据进行查询和分析,以支持决策和规划工作。数据库提供了强大的查询和分析功能,可以通过SQL语句进行复杂的空间查询和空间分析,从而提取出所需的地理信息。
-
数据共享和交换:GIS系统通常需要与其他系统进行数据共享和交换。数据库可以提供标准的接口和协议,方便数据的共享和交换。同时,数据库还可以实现数据的备份和恢复,保证数据的安全性和可靠性。
-
数据更新和维护:地理空间数据是动态变化的,需要及时更新和维护。数据库提供了数据更新和维护的功能,可以实现数据的增删改查操作,确保GIS系统的数据始终保持最新和准确。
建立数据库的操作流程如下:
-
数据需求分析:首先需要明确GIS系统的数据需求,包括要存储的数据类型、数据量、数据更新频率等。根据需求分析结果,确定数据库的数据模型和结构。
-
数据库设计:根据数据需求和数据模型,进行数据库的设计。包括确定数据库的表结构、字段定义、索引设置等。
-
数据导入:将现有的地理空间数据导入到数据库中。可以使用GIS软件提供的数据导入工具,将地图、矢量数据、栅格数据等导入到数据库中。
-
数据管理和维护:通过数据库管理工具,对数据库进行管理和维护。包括数据备份和恢复、数据更新和维护、数据查询和分析等操作。
-
数据共享和交换:根据需要,设置数据库的共享和交换方式。可以通过网络共享、数据发布服务、数据交换标准等方式,与其他系统进行数据共享和交换。
总之,建立数据库是GIS系统中的重要环节,它可以提供高效的数据管理和查询功能,为GIS系统的决策和规划工作提供支持。建立数据库的操作流程包括数据需求分析、数据库设计、数据导入、数据管理和维护、数据共享和交换等步骤。
1年前 -